- 精华
- 0
- 帖子
- 176
- 威望
- 0 点
- 积分
- 708 点
- 种子
- 804 点
- 注册时间
- 2012-9-4
- 最后登录
- 2024-9-8
|
楼主 |
发表于 2018-10-20 20:18 · 四川
|
显示全部楼层
本帖最后由 slime525 于 2018-10-20 20:58 编辑
已解决原来我弄好了win10还要手动启用smb才行,下面教程文件
1安卓下安装盒子伴侣一键自动安装Optware
2win下安装Putty,记下盒子ip端口,账户密码分别是:root,toor。小写!
3然后直接输入:ipkg-opt install samba
就会自动下载并安装Samba3.2.15-5版本,Samba的推荐版本。由于是在线下载安装,服务器又在国外,所以等待时间可能会长,耐心!
(用 ipkg-opt update命令可以下载服务器上文件的清单,下载之后保存在/opt/lib/ipkg/lists/cross,用FTP连上去下载查看。可以看到Samba的版本由samba2到samba36之中有许多版本,samba3等等,3.5更高的版本需要更多库支持,不适合路由器上面安装。千万别装Samba2,我折腾了半天都没有解决乱码的问题,最后还是装Samba3.2.15-5解决的乱码问题。)
(如果在线安装失败了,或者您不愿意等那么久,可以在运行ipkg-opt install samba之后看到Samba3.2.15-5的下载地址,复制到迅雷里面下载之后,用flashxp(ip端口用户密码同上)传到/opt/lib/ipkg/lists/samba_3.2.15-5_arm.ipk,然后执行ipkg-opt install /opt/lib/ipkg/lists/samba_3.2.15-5_arm.ipk,这样会节约很多时间。)
安装完毕。
修改配置。
安装完成后需要修改的是"opt/etc/samba/smb.conf", 文件名或者为"smb.conf.*******", 重命名为"smb.conf"即可.
复制下面的配置到"smb.conf"保存.
[global]
bind interfaces only = yes
workgroup = Workgroup
server string = NAS
guest account = root
security = share
load printers = no
socket options = TCP_NODELAY IPTOS_LOWDELAY SO_KEEPALIVE
netbios name = NAS
browseable = yes
dns proxy = no
guest ok = yes
guest only = no
log level = 1
max log size = 100
encrypt passwords = yes
preserve case = yes
short preserve case = yes
wins support = yes
time server = yes
os level = 255
local master = yes
domain master = yes
preferred master = yes
[Downloads]
path = /storage/sda1/Transmission
browseable = yes
writable = yes
请根据自己的路由IP和共享地址修改, 如果觉得使用无线的时候Samba速度过慢, 可以试试为输出输入添加8M的缓冲(会增大16M的内存开销, 但速度提升明显), 将上面的
socket options = TCP_NODELAY IPTOS_LOWDELAY SO_KEEPALIVE
改为:
socket options = TCP_NODELAY SO_RCVBUF=8192 SO_SNDBUF=8192
之后修改"/opt/etc/init.d/S08samba"这个文件,以下为我的 S08samba 里面的代码(不能用记事本写字板改只能用flashxp右键编辑)
#!/bin/sh
samba_active=1
if [ -n "`pidof smbd`" ] ; then
echo "Stopping smbd:"
killall smbd
fi
if [ -n "`pidof nmbd`" ] ; then
echo "Stopping nmbd:"
killall nmbd
fi
#sleep 2
echo "Starting smbd:"
/opt/sbin/smbd -D;
echo "Starting nmbd:"
/opt/sbin/nmbd -D;
全部完成后就输入下面命令启动Samba
# /opt/etc/init.d/S08samba
回显为:
Starting smbd:
Starting nmbd:
到此就全部搞定。
https://pan.luryl.com/s/1cE67Hg9UCSWRlsxzMGFCeA |
|